Concerning the proper lubrication of a ring-oiled line shaft bearing, what statement is true?
A) The oil level should be maintained high enough so that some oil is seen exiting the bearing along the shaft.
B) The oil level should be high enough so that the oiling rings dip into the oil, but the rings must not be allowed to freely rotate with the shaft.
C) The oil level should be high enough so that the oiling rings dip into the oil, and the rings must freely rotate with the shaft.
D) The oil level should be maintained high enough so that the entire bearing is continuously flooded.
